Analysis

In 2021, silk waste — other uses in Western Africa stood at 64.95 t.

The figure is down 58.8% on the previous year and up 6,395.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, silk waste — other uses in Western Africa peaked at 157.59 t in 2020 and was at its lowest, 0.6 t, in 2014.

That places Western Africa 11th out of 27 groups with data for 2021, putting it in the middle of the range.

Silk waste — Other uses in Western Africa, year by year

Annual values for Silk waste — Other uses (non-food) in Western Africa, 2013 to 2021.
Year t Change
2013 1 t
2014 0.6 t -40.0%
2015 1 t +66.7%
2016 7 t +600.0%
2017 8 t +14.3%
2019 22 t +175.0%
2020 157.59 t +616.3%
2021 64.95 t -58.8%
